MORE TROUBLE AT BLACKBALL.

ANOTHER STRIKE PROBABLE.

By Telegraph—Preas Association* GREYMOUTH, December 22.

The miners at Blackball are very much discontented over the recent award made by the Arbitration Court on the pillar rate which came into lorce on the 14th instant. The price paid under the old award was 2s 4d a ton and the new award reduces it to 2s 2d.

The matter has been referred to the Miners' Federation and the Blackball miners trust that it will uphold them in refusing to work under the altered conditions. The general opinion is that the New Year will witness another strike.
